Biography

Morteza Kayyalha is an Assistant Professor in the School of Electrical Engineering and Computer Science at Pennsylvania State University. His research focuses on Electronic Materials and Devices, as well as Optical Materials, Devices, and Systems. The School of Electrical Engineering and Computer Science was established to enhance educational access and promote collaborative research opportunities across undergraduate and graduate programs. Dr. Kayyalha participates in graduate education, offering master's and Ph.D. degrees in electrical engineering and computer science. His work emphasizes the convergence of technologies across various disciplines to address current industrial needs and challenges.
